Stefano Olla 氏 (University of Paris-Dauphine)
Entropy and hypo-coercive methods in hydrodynamic limits
Stefano Olla 氏 (University of Paris-Dauphine)
Entropy and hypo-coercive methods in hydrodynamic limits
[ 講演概要 ]
Relative Entropy and entropy production have been main tools
in obtaining hydrodynamic limits Entropic hypo-coercivity can be used to
extend this method to dynamics with highly degenerate noise. I will
apply it to a chain of anharmonic oscillators immersed in a temperature
gradient. Stationary states of these dynamics are of ’non equilibrium’,
and their entropy production does not allow the application of previous
techniques. These dynamics model microscopically an isothermal
thermodynamic transformation between non-equilibrium stationary states.
